potato install on AX and AXi
Hi,
I installed debian potato on an AX and AXi. On the whole it went smoothly,
here are the problems I found:
- ln -s /dev/fb0 /dev/fb - already reported
- gpm + X hangs - already reported
- There is a binfmt_elf.o module even though this is compiled into the
kernel. Running depmod gives unresolved symbols, more an annoyance than a bug.
- The AXi type 5 keyboard was found by the X server as a type 2. The XF86Config
had to be manually edited for it to work. I will look into this.
